Flour conveying systems are fundamental components in the flour milling and processing industry, engineered to efficiently transport flour from storage silos to various processing units. These systems are critical for maintaining the quality and consistency of flour, which is essential for downstream applications such as baking and food production. The primary objective of a flour conveying system is to ensure smooth, hygienic movement of flour, minimizing the risk of contamination and optimizing performance within the production line.

Among the diverse methods for flour transportation, pneumatic conveying emerges as a highly effective and versatile solution. Pneumatic flour conveyors utilize air pressure to move flour through a network of pipes, offering distinct advantages over traditional mechanical systems. This approach is particularly suited for handling fine powders like flour, as it reduces product degradation and ensures a clean, dust-free operation. The system typically comprises a blower, a hopper, and a series of pipes, with flour drawn into the system and propelled to the desired location.
One of the most significant benefits of pneumatic flour conveying is its capacity to handle high volumes of material with minimal labor. The system operates continuously, reducing the need for manual handling and associated risks. Additionally, pneumatic conveyors are highly adaptable, allowing for easy reconfiguration to accommodate changes in production needs or facility layout. This flexibility makes them ideal for both new installations and retrofitting existing mills.

Another key advantage is the hygienic nature of pneumatic conveying. Unlike mechanical systems that may cause friction and product degradation, pneumatic systems use air to move flour, preserving its quality and freshness. This is especially critical in food processing, where maintaining product integrity is paramount. The enclosed piping system also helps control dust emissions, contributing to a cleaner working environment and compliance with environmental regulations.

Modern pneumatic flour conveying systems are equipped with advanced features that enhance performance and reliability. These include variable speed blowers, which allow precise control of air flow and pressure for optimal conveying efficiency. The systems often incorporate dust collection and filtration systems to maintain air quality and prevent product contamination. Many contemporary designs also use stainless steel components, which are resistant to corrosion and easy to clean, further enhancing durability and hygiene.
